megalomania

English

Noun

(wikipedia megalomania) (en noun)
  • A psychopathological condition characterized by delusional fantasies of wealth, power, or omnipotence.
  • An obsession with grandiose or extravagant things or actions.
  • Synonyms

    * (psychopathological condition) delusion of grandeur

    aspersion

    English

    Noun

    (en noun)
  • An attack on somebody's reputation or good name, often in the phrase to cast aspersions upon… .
  • *
  • (label) A sprinkling of .
  • * 1610 , , act 4 scene 1
  • If thou dost break her virgin knot before
    All sanctimonious ceremonies may
    With full and holy rite be minister'd,
    No sweet aspersion shall the heavens let fall
    To make this contract grow; but barren hate [...]
